Home | History | Annotate | Download | only in layout

Lines Matching refs:targetNode

256     public void onPaste(@NonNull INode targetNode, @Nullable Object targetView,
258 DropFeedback feedback = onDropEnter(targetNode, targetView, elements);
260 Point p = targetNode.getBounds().getTopLeft();
261 feedback = onDropMove(targetNode, elements, feedback, p);
263 onDropLeave(targetNode, elements, feedback);
264 onDropped(targetNode, elements, feedback, p);
279 * @param targetNode the first selected node
282 public void onPasteBeforeChild(INode parentNode, Object parentView, INode targetNode,
287 Point targetP = targetNode.getBounds().getTopLeft();
328 * createNewIds to true to find the existing IDs under targetNode and create
333 protected static Map<String, Pair<String, String>> getDropIdMap(INode targetNode,
340 idMap = remapIds(targetNode, idMap);
572 * @param targetNode the node to insert into
575 * @param initialInsertPos index among targetnode's children which to insert the
578 public static void insertAt(final INode targetNode, final IDragElement[] elements,
583 final Map<String, Pair<String, String>> idMap = getDropIdMap(targetNode, elements,
586 targetNode.editXml("Insert Elements", new INodeHandler() {
595 INode newChild = targetNode.insertChildAt(fqcn, insertPos);